How much do Substitute Teachers, Short-Term make?
Your level of experience is a key factor in determining your earning potential. Here's what you can expect at different career stages:
0-2 years
Hourly Rate
$17.94/hr
Range: $15.84 – $22.60
Annual Rate
$37,308
Range: $32,938 – $47,011
3-5 years
Hourly Rate
$21.10/hr
Range: $18.63 – $26.59
Annual Rate
$43,892
Range: $38,750 – $55,307
6+ years
Hourly Rate
$24.27/hr
Range: $21.42 – $30.58
Annual Rate
$50,476
Range: $44,563 – $63,603
Substitute Teachers, Short-Term job description
Substitute Teachers, Short-Term professionals are dedicated to educating and inspiring students at various levels. They develop curricula, create engaging learning experiences, and help students achieve their academic and personal goals.
- •Develop and deliver educational content
- •Assess student progress and provide feedback
- •Create inclusive learning environments
- •Communicate with students and parents
- •Maintain classroom management
- •Participate in professional development
